women's cardigan 1 - anne

COZY CABLED CARDIGAN


 

woman_sweater_anne




DESIGN DETAILS
- Relaxed fit
- Low round neckline
- Dropped shoulder
- Zipper closure
- Three dissimilar interesting cables on the fronts and sleeves
- Exposed side and underarm seams


PATTERN DETAILS - the easy to follow pattern includes:
- Schematic for each piece
- A helpful tracking sheet for cables
- Diagrams and full explanations of techniques used, plus selected links to videos
- A link for substitute yarn

TECHNIQUES USED IN THIS PATTERN
Links to videos for selected techniques are included
- Cast-on
- Bind-off
- Reverse Stockinette stitch
- Bobbles
- Single crochet
- Using a cable needle
- Picking up and knitting stitches
- Weaving separate sleeves-(stitches to rows) to side edges of body

Regardless of body measurements, everyone prefers a different finished look. It is helpful to use the “measurements of the finished garment” to decide which size to make. The following measurements refer to this specific garment only. It can help you find the best look for you.

YARN USED FOR SAMPLE
Plymouth Yarns--Baby Alpaca dk
100 % alpaca
1.75 ounces-(
50 grams)       125 yards-(114.3 m) each ball

12(13—15—16—18) balls

For your cardigan to be the correct size, it is not the brand of yarn that matters, but the GAUGE that is important. It is best to refer to the yardage to determine how many skeins or balls to purchase.


FOR A SUBSTITUTE YARN CLICK HERE


SUGGESTED NEEDLE SIZES
- size 4-(3.5 mm) or size needles to obtain the correct gauge
- size F crochet hook


NOTIONS

- gauge ruler
- tapestry needle
- separating zipper
- cable needle
- coiless pins or split ring markers

GAUGE
- 25 stitches and 36 rows = 4 inches-(10 cm) in reverse stockinette stitch on size 4 needle-(3.5 mm) needles
